Transaction 6a8c32bb23edf6ec5ee9b33490ccc243841b792c8c96040d1897443822b1f689
1 Input
1 Output
-
6a8c32bb23edf6ec5ee9b33490ccc243841b792c8c96040d1897443822b1f689:0
- value
- 102938
- script pubkey
- OP_0 OP_PUSHBYTES_20 c3f6fe807f0e56be52d97d8950bd808f1891971a
- address
- bc1qc0m0aqrlpettu5ke0ky4p0vq3uvfr9c6mu0sn5